Description

This specimen displays the vibrant yellow ray florets of a Tuberous Hawkbit flower, viewed from beneath, revealing the green bracts and ribbed stem. The petals show a reddish-brown stripe on their underside. It is a common wildflower, not typically cultivated as a bonsai.
